What is a garage door threshold?

The garage door threshold is the bottom seal that sits on the concrete floor beneath the door. It acts as a transition between the outdoors and the interior, blocking water, dirt, pests, and drafts from entering the garage when the door is closed. Thresholds are typically a rigid strip with a flexible seal (gasket) that compresses against the door bottom. While the exact design varies by model and installation, the core function remains consistent: to create a continuous barrier along the bottom edge of the door. A well-fitted threshold also helps distribute the load across the door bottom, reducing wear and tear on the door itself. Why thresholds matter for protection and energy efficiency

A threshold works in concert with side weatherstripping along the door jambs to seal the entire bottom perimeter of the doorway. When the threshold and seals are in good condition, they prevent rain, snow, mud, and dust from entering the garage, and they keep heated or cooled air from slipping out. This reduces energy loss and can lower heating and cooling costs over time. A degraded threshold can allow water to pool against the door base, accelerate floor damage, and invite pests or mold growth. From an energy standpoint, a tight seal minimizes air leakage, which is especially noticeable during extreme weather. Types of thresholds and how they work

Thresholds come in several common profiles, each designed to seal against bottom-up and sideward gaps. The most typical categories include fixed thresholds made of metal or vinyl, and adjustable thresholds that use a leveling mechanism to compensate for floor irregularities. Many thresholds incorporate a bulb or gasket that compresses against the door bottom when closed, creating a tight seal. Some homes use a combination threshold with a raised edge or flange that directs water away from the doorway. The right choice depends on floor condition, climate, and door type. Regardless of style, a threshold should align flush with the door bottom and match the weatherstripping along the sides for a complete seal. If your floor is uneven or the threshold is wavy, you may need to level or replace it to regain an effective seal.

How to inspect your threshold

Begin with a visual inspection for cracks, chips, or warping in the threshold itself. Look for gaps where the gasket meets the door bottom or where the threshold edge has separated from the floor. Test the seal by closing the door and sliding a dollar bill or a narrow piece of plastic between the door and the threshold at several points; if you can pull it out easily without resistance, the seal may be compromised. Check for moisture staining or damp patches along the threshold and adjacent floor, especially after rain or heavy snows. Ensure the threshold sits level; a noticeable tilt can create a pathway for water to seep under the door. Clear any debris that can impede the seal, such as gravel, leaves, or dirt, then re-check both the threshold and side weatherstripping to confirm a snug fit. If your floor shows significant cracking or the threshold remains loose after resealing, replacement is likely the best option.

Regular inspection should be part of your seasonal maintenance routine, with more frequent checks in climates with seasonal freeze-thaw cycles.

How to replace or repair a threshold

If replacement is needed, start by removing the existing threshold screws or fasteners. Carefully pry the threshold away from the floor, taking care not to damage the surrounding concrete. Clean the surface to remove old adhesive or debris. Measure the width and thickness accurately, then cut the new threshold to length with a fine-tooth saw (if needed) and fit it into place. Apply a thin bead of exterior-grade sealant along the underside to create a moisture barrier, then secure the threshold with screws or clips per the manufacturer’s instructions. Reinstall or upgrade side weatherstripping if worn, and ensure the door seals evenly against the new threshold when closed. After installation, test the seal again with a dollar bill test and observe for any drafts or water intrusion during rain or snow. If concrete or floor settlement has occurred, consider professional leveling in addition to threshold replacement to ensure proper alignment and sealing.

For minor issues, you may be able to repair the gasket itself by cleaning and reconditioning it, but persistent warping or cracks usually require a full replacement to restore integrity.

Common issues and quick fixes

Worn or compressed gaskets can often be refreshed with cleaning and reconditioning products, but persistent compression loss usually means replacement. A warped or cracked threshold will not seal properly and should be replaced. Floor settlement or concrete cracking beneath the threshold can create gaps even with a new seal; in such cases, professional assessment of concrete leveling may be necessary. Debris buildup on the threshold surface prevents full contact with the door, so regular cleaning is a simple, effective fix. In cold climates, thermal contraction can cause gaps to appear, while moisture can cause swelling in vinyl thresholds. If you notice water pooling near the threshold after rain, check for improper slope and ensure the threshold is correctly aligned. Thresholds, weather-stripping, and overall door maintenance integration

A threshold does not work in isolation. It relies on compatible weather-stripping along the door sides to seal effectively. Regular maintenance should include cleaning and inspecting the threshold, checking the side seals, and testing door balance and alignment. If the door frequently strikes the threshold, that impact can wear down both the seal and the floor surface, accelerating the need for maintenance. Ensure the door is balanced so it closes squarely and stays in alignment; misalignment can compromise the threshold seal and allow drafts or water ingress. For homeowners, establishing a seasonal maintenance routine—inspect the threshold, lubricate hardware, test seals, and replace worn weatherstripping—reduces the odds of water damage, drafts, and pest entry.
